232 changes: 232 additions & 0 deletions internal/arch/arch.go
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,232 @@
// Package arch implements the m/v waterline gates — the machine-checkable
// boundary between the engine-neutral `m` layer and the VistA-specific `v`
// layer (see docs/background/m-v-waterline-adr.md in the org `docs` repo).
//
// This stage ships G1 — dependency-direction — the core invariant: dependency
// flows one way, v → m, never the reverse. A repo declares its layer in a
// committed meta artifact ("layer": "m"|"v"); the gate then asserts that an
// `m`-layer repo's Go dependency closure contains no `vista-cloud-dev/v-*`
// module, and that its M source references no `VSL*` (v-layer) routine. A
// `v`-layer repo passes G1 trivially (v → m is allowed).
package arch

import (
"bytes"
"encoding/json"
"fmt"
"io"
"io/fs"
"os"
"os/exec"
"path/filepath"
"regexp"
"strings"
)

// Layer is a repo's side of the waterline.
type Layer string

const (
// LayerM is the engine-neutral layer (runs on a bare M engine, no VistA).
LayerM Layer = "m"
// LayerV is the VistA-specific layer (needs Kernel/FileMan/KIDS).
LayerV Layer = "v"
)

// vModulePrefix is the import-path prefix every VistA-specific Go module
// shares (v-pkg, v-cli, v-stdlib, …). An m-layer closure must not contain it.
const vModulePrefix = "github.com/vista-cloud-dev/v-"

// vRoutineRef matches a reference to a v-layer (VSL*) M routine in any call
// form — ^VSLCFG, $$tag^VSLCFG, do x^VSLCFG — since all contain "^VSL".
var vRoutineRef = regexp.MustCompile(`\^VSL[A-Z0-9]*`)

// Violation is one G1 finding — a dependency that crosses the waterline the
// wrong way (m → v).
type Violation struct {
Gate string `json:"gate"` // "G1"
Kind string `json:"kind"` // "go-dep" | "m-ref"
Source string `json:"source"` // offending module path or file:line
Detail string `json:"detail"` // human-readable explanation
}

// Report is the full G1 result for one repo.
type Report struct {
Layer Layer `json:"layer"`
CheckedGo bool `json:"checkedGo"`
CheckedM bool `json:"checkedM"`
Violations []Violation `json:"violations"`
}

// metaCandidates are the committed meta artifacts, in priority order, that may
// carry the repo's "layer" declaration (ADR §3.1).
var metaCandidates = []string{
filepath.Join("dist", "repo.meta.json"),
filepath.Join("dist", "v-contract.json"),
"repo.meta.json", // repos whose dist/ is gitignored (e.g. m-cli)
}

// ResolveLayer determines the repo's declared layer. An explicit override
// ("m"/"v") wins; otherwise the top-level "layer" field of a known committed
// meta artifact is read (dist/repo.meta.json, then dist/v-contract.json).
func ResolveLayer(root, override string) (Layer, error) {
if override != "" {
switch Layer(override) {
case LayerM, LayerV:
return Layer(override), nil
default:
return "", fmt.Errorf("invalid layer override %q (want m or v)", override)
}
}
for _, rel := range metaCandidates {
body, err := os.ReadFile(filepath.Join(root, rel))
if err != nil {
continue
}
var meta struct {
Layer string `json:"layer"`
}
if err := json.Unmarshal(body, &meta); err != nil {
return "", fmt.Errorf("%s: %w", rel, err)
}
if meta.Layer == "" {
continue
}
switch Layer(meta.Layer) {
case LayerM, LayerV:
return Layer(meta.Layer), nil
default:
return "", fmt.Errorf(`%s: invalid "layer" %q (want m or v)`, rel, meta.Layer)
}
}
return "", fmt.Errorf(`no "layer" declared — add it to dist/repo.meta.json or dist/v-contract.json, or pass --layer`)
}

// parseGoListDeps extracts the distinct module import paths from the streamed
// JSON objects emitted by `go list -deps -json ./...`.
func parseGoListDeps(stream []byte) ([]string, error) {
dec := json.NewDecoder(bytes.NewReader(stream))
seen := map[string]bool{}
var mods []string
for {
var pkg struct {
Module *struct {
Path string `json:"Path"`
} `json:"Module"`
}
if err := dec.Decode(&pkg); err == io.EOF {
break
} else if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
if pkg.Module == nil || pkg.Module.Path == "" || seen[pkg.Module.Path] {
continue
}
seen[pkg.Module.Path] = true
mods = append(mods, pkg.Module.Path)
}
return mods, nil
}

// vViolations flags any vista-cloud-dev/v-* module appearing in an m-layer
// dependency closure (the m → v G1 violation).
func vViolations(modulePaths []string) []Violation {
var vs []Violation
for _, p := range modulePaths {
if strings.HasPrefix(p, vModulePrefix) {
vs = append(vs, Violation{
Gate: "G1", Kind: "go-dep", Source: p,
Detail: "m-layer module depends on a v-layer module (v → m only)",
})
}
}
return vs
}

// goListModules runs `go list -deps -json ./...` in root and returns the
// distinct module paths in the dependency closure.
func goListModules(root string) ([]string, error) {
cmd := exec.Command("go", "list", "-deps", "-json", "./...")
cmd.Dir = root
var out, errBuf bytes.Buffer
cmd.Stdout, cmd.Stderr = &out, &errBuf
if err := cmd.Run(); err != nil {
return nil, fmt.Errorf("go list: %w: %s", err, strings.TrimSpace(errBuf.String()))
}
return parseGoListDeps(out.Bytes())
}

// CheckMRefs scans the .m source under root for references to v-layer (VSL*)
// routines — the M-side m → v G1 violation. Generated/vendored trees are
// skipped (dist, vendor, .git, node_modules).
func CheckMRefs(root string) ([]Violation, error) {
var vs []Violation
err := filepath.WalkDir(root, func(path string, d fs.DirEntry, err error) error {
if err != nil {
return err
}
if d.IsDir() {
switch d.Name() {
case ".git", "dist", "vendor", "node_modules":
return filepath.SkipDir
}
return nil
}
if strings.ToLower(filepath.Ext(path)) != ".m" {
return nil
}
body, err := os.ReadFile(path)
if err != nil {
return err
}
rel, relErr := filepath.Rel(root, path)
if relErr != nil {
rel = path
}
for i, line := range strings.Split(string(body), "\n") {
if m := vRoutineRef.FindString(line); m != "" {
vs = append(vs, Violation{
Gate: "G1", Kind: "m-ref",
Source: fmt.Sprintf("%s:%d", rel, i+1),
Detail: fmt.Sprintf("m-layer routine references v-layer routine %s", m),
})
}
}
return nil
})
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
return vs, nil
}

// Check resolves the repo layer and runs the applicable G1 checks. A v-layer
// repo passes trivially (v → m is allowed); an m-layer repo is checked on both
// the Go dependency closure (when a go.mod is present) and its M source.
func Check(root, override string) (Report, error) {
layer, err := ResolveLayer(root, override)
if err != nil {
return Report{}, err
}
rep := Report{Layer: layer}
if layer == LayerV {
return rep, nil
}
// Go dependency-direction (only when the repo is a Go module).
if _, statErr := os.Stat(filepath.Join(root, "go.mod")); statErr == nil {
mods, err := goListModules(root)
if err != nil {
return rep, err
}
rep.CheckedGo = true
rep.Violations = append(rep.Violations, vViolations(mods)...)
}
// M-side dependency-direction (STD* → VSL*).
mvs, err := CheckMRefs(root)
if err != nil {
return rep, err
}
rep.CheckedM = true
rep.Violations = append(rep.Violations, mvs...)
return rep, nil
}
